China Retaliates with 125% Tariffs as Trade War Intensifies: Beijing struck back against U.S. tariffs by raising levies on American goods to 125% from 84%. The tit-for-tat increases stand to make trade between the world's largest economies virtually impossible. Read more

South Korean President Removed from Office: Yoon Suk Yeol was officially removed after the Constitutional Court unanimously upheld parliament's impeachment over his imposition of martial law. This political earthquake sets in motion a presidential race with elections required within 60 days. Read more

Tech Companies Get Tariff Reprieve: After market turbulence, Trump exempted smartphones, computers, and other electronics from hefty tariffs imposed on Chinese goods. Tech analyst Dan Ives called this move a removal of a "doomsday scenario" for the sector. Read more

Senate Confirms Dan Caine as Chairman of Joint Chiefs: The Senate voted 60-25 to approve Caine's nomination, following Trump's unprecedented firing of his predecessor. Caine promised to remain apolitical and follow U.S. laws during his confirmation. Read more

Tahawwur Rana Extradited to India for 26/11 Case: The Pakistani-born Canadian businessman landed in Delhi and was taken into custody by India's National Investigation Agency. This represents a major diplomatic win secured directly from President Trump during Modi's February visit. Read more

Waqf Amendment Act Sparks Protests: The recently passed act making changes to how Muslim religious properties are governed has triggered widespread demonstrations across India. Some protests turned violent, particularly in West Bengal's Murshidabad district. Read more

F1: Max Verstappen won the Japanese Grand Prix on April 6, marking his fourth consecutive victory at Suzuka. The reigning world champion converted his pole position into a win, with McLaren drivers Lando Norris and Oscar Piastri completing the podium. In the championship standings, Norris maintains a slim one-point lead over Verstappen (62 points to 61) after three races. Read more
NBA: With the regular season wrapping up this weekend, the NBA playoff picture is taking shape. The Minnesota Timberwolves have secured the #1 seed in the Western Conference for the first time in franchise history, while the Boston Celtics locked up the top spot in the East. The play-in tournament begins Tuesday, April 15, with the full playoffs starting Saturday, April 19. Read more

This comedy series about two pampered Pakistani-American brothers who discover their deceased father's convenience store empire is actually a front for a criminal enterprise has been climbing Hulu's "Top 15 Today" list since its March release.
Quick Take: Created by Abdullah Saeed and produced by Onyx Collective, "Deli Boys" blends crime comedy with cultural specificity. Asif Ali and Saagar Shaikh deliver standout performances as brothers navigating their unexpected criminal inheritance, with uniquely Pakistani-American humor throughout.
